Catechin /ˈkætɪtʃɪn/ is a flavan-3-ol, a type of natural phenol and antioxidant. It is a plant secondary metabolite. It belongs to the group of flavan-3-ols (or simply flavanols), part of the chemical family of flavonoids.

A method for determining the content of gallic acid and (+)-catechin in sesame medicinal material.

This invention discloses a method for determining the content of gallic acid and (+)-catechin in *Hedysarum heterotropoides* medicinal materials. After reflux treatment with 60% methanol solution in a water bath, the *Hedysarum heterotropoides* medicinal materials are subjected to high-performance liquid chromatography (HPLC) with octadecyl-bonded silica gel as the stationary phase and acetonitrile (A)-0.1% phosphoric acid aqueous solution (B) as the mobile phase. The peak area values ​​of gallic acid and (+)-catechin showed good linearity in the injection amounts of 10.00–100.0 μg and 200.0–2000 μg, respectively, with average recoveries of 98.31% and 97.68%, and RSD values ​​of 1.2% and 1.2%, respectively. The method is simple and accurate, and can be used for the determination of gallic acid and (+)-catechin content, providing a theoretical basis for the quality control of *Hedysarum heterotropoides* medicinal materials.

Preparation and application of bone targeting catechin-strontium metal polyphenol nanoparticles

PendingCN121891548AAchieve synchronous deliveryImplement sequential releaseSkeletal disorderPharmaceutical non-active ingredientsBone regenerationBone quality
The invention discloses a preparation method and an application of a bone targeting catechin-strontium metal polyphenol nano particle. The system takes a metal-polyphenol network (MPN) formed by coordination self-assembly of strontium ions and catechin as a core, and tetracycline is modified on the surface of the MPN to construct a bone targeting functional layer. The MPN structure can significantly enhance the loading efficiency and physiological stability of catechin, and the tetracycline modification on the surface endows the nanoparticles with excellent bone targeting ability. When reaching an osteoporosis focus, the nanoparticles can respond to a local weakly acidic microenvironment and controllably release catechin, and exert antioxidant and anti-inflammatory effects, thereby reversing a pathological microenvironment unfavorable for bone regeneration. Meanwhile, the MPN skeleton is gradually degraded in vivo, and the released Sr < 2 + > can promote proliferation and differentiation of pre-osteogenic cells, inhibit the activity of osteoclasts and promote formation of new bones. The system integrates bone targeting, microenvironment response drug release, immunoregulation and ion regulation treatment, and provides a new strategy for precise treatment of osteoporosis.

Nanoparticles for improving stability of catechin and preparation method thereof

The invention discloses a nano-particle for improving stability of catechin and a preparation method thereof, the nano-particle comprises catechin, lactoprotein, chitosan and sodium tripolyphosphate according to a weight ratio, the catechin nano-particle is constructed by adopting a self-assembly strategy, the preparation process is simple and convenient, and the conditions are mild. The raw materials are all safe and reliable food-grade or edible components which are wide in source and sufficient in supply, and the method has good amplification performance and industrial application prospects. The encapsulation efficiency is 90% or above, active ingredients can be effectively embedded and protected, the stability of catechin under various complex or extreme environment conditions such as high temperature, illumination and alkalinity is remarkably improved, the stability under the extremely high temperature condition is improved by 10 times or above, and the stability under the alkaline condition is improved by 12 times or above; the technical problem that catechin is easy to degrade and inactivate in the processing and storage process is fundamentally solved. The catechin can better adapt to food processing, health care product production and related application scenes, the practical application range of the catechin is greatly widened, and the added value of the product is improved.
